Cobra M-Speed Offset Driver Loft Chart

The Cobra M-Speed Offset driver has 2 listed factory loft options. The listed lofts are 10.5° and 12°. The chart focuses on the stated head lofts themselves; actual launch and spin still depend on delivery, strike and the rest of the build.

10.5° vs 12°

Moving from 10.5° to 12° adds 1.5° of static loft. The higher-loft option generally starts from an easier-launching, higher-spin baseline.

Fitting note: The chart is based on the stated factory lofts. Actual playing loft and flight can vary with build, lie, shaft lean, setup and strike.

Can you adjust the loft?

No user-adjustable loft sleeve is fitted to the M-Speed Offset. Its loft is set by the head. There is no hosel ring to rotate: changing shafts does not change the head’s loft, and a driver/fairway/hybrid hosel should not be bent like an iron. To materially change loft, use a different factory-loft head/model or have a qualified fitter confirm whether any specialist modification is possible.

Does more loft always mean a better result?

No. The best loft depends on the club type, player delivery, strike and the distance or trajectory window you are trying to hit.
